Compared to its Rocker sibling, the Arbor Coda Split Camber is the more 'aggressive' of the two. The System Camber with its bamboo strips gives it a natural flex with lots of pop. This board is perfect for the experienced snowboarder looking for a board that can handle any condition. The Coda is designed to be versatile. Whether you are planning a day on the slopes or exploring the backcountry, this board can do it all. The camber shape in this board ensures lots of precision and responsiveness and gives a lot of traction on your way up.
This split comes with custom skins from Kohla.
In detail
PROFILE
The Camber System Arbor's System Camber shapes are for riders who want: A highly responsive ride, crisp on-edge performance, and more pop for carving and ollie., Effortless true-camber performance across all types of snow, and during turns, spins, and landings.
Parabolic Profiling Arbor uses a unique shaping technique that replaces single radius arc found in traditional camber or rocker, with a more advanced parabolic profile. The design blends five separate radii together to create a parabolic arc, which gradually reduces the amount of rocker or camber toward the tip and tail. In Arbors System Rocker shapes, the design lowers the leading edge to improve edge hold. In the System Camber shapes, the design makes the leading edge less aggressive for smoother performance. The blended five radii design also drastically improves the ability to tune each shape in line for ability level, target terrain, and riding style.
Thunderhead Arbor has a different nose profile for every type of terrain. The Thunderhead is suitable for big-mountain versatility & speed in the deepest snow.
4 Point Camber 4 Point – 1.5 degrees, Park/Street Performance, Built in 1° De-Tune. The 4point System Camber is the optimal setup at speed, through steeps and deep carves.
CORE
FSC Certified Higland Split Core Arbor's highly versatile FSC Certified Highland Core with additional insert and centerline components for a premium factory splitboard.
REINFORCEMENTS
RWD Carbon Uprights Two carbon fiber uprights running from the tip and tail to just past the inserts. A set up that provides added landing durability and pop for bigger park and backcountry performance.
Mixed Glassing A triax over biax lay–up that’s best for versatility: pow, backcountry, groomers, jumps, and more.
TOPSHEET
Powerply Topsheet The Power Ply works like an added layer of fiberglass. During construction, the natural wood or bamboo fibers are turned into a composite layer inside the board, but the process takes time. They start with a log that must be soaked so that it can be sliced or “veneered” into sheets, which are then assembled into “faces”. The “faces” are then backed with a special fleece material, precision sanded, and pre laminated to a protective foil made in part from natural castor bean oil. The finished topsheet is at last ready to be built into a snowboard. In the end, the process makes Arbor Power Ply designs the most labor intensive snowboards on the market. The resulting performance, board life, finish quality, reduced reliance on man–made glues, coatings, and composites are worth the extra effort.
Entropy Bio Resin All Powerplys and R.A.P. Topless Tech veneers are made with Entropy Bio-Resin, a replacement for traditional petroleum based resin that doesn’t affect performance or usability. The ingredients that go into Entropy Bio-Resin are sArbor’sced as co-products or waste products of other industrial processes and are manufactured employing green chemistry techniques that reduce the carbon footprint of the material by up to 40% (when compared to its petroleum based equivalent).
R.A.P Topless Technology A build process in which we eliminate the need for our Bio-Plastic Topsheet, creating a lighter, more eco-friendly ride.
BASE
Sintered base A higher molecular weight, sintered base that provides added durability and speed.
Wend Natural Wax All boards are waxed and ready to use.
SIDEWALL
ABS (recycled) Sidewall Provides enhanced durability while keeping the core safe from moisture.When a plastic alternative is unavailable, as in the case of ABS sidewalls, Arbor has choosen for a recycled material to improve the sustainability of their products.
EDGES
Griptech Grip tech is a tri–radial sidecut design that is not “blended.” Natural shaping intersections, that in the past were eliminated, have been transformed into heel and toe contact points that provide a direct, more ergonomic way to grip the snow when additional control is needed. The extra contacts also form pivot zones that make turning easier and more natural. Grip tech effectively moves a board’s primary interface with the snow underfoot, allowing us to deliver designs that don’t lose performance as we lift leading sections of the effective edge from the snow for a less grabby ride. Those designs include rocker, or camber with our new uprise fenders. Uprise fenders pull the outside contact zones off the snow with angled 3º risers on all camber system designs.
Recycled Steel Edges Highly durable, recycled steel edges embody two of Arbor's key values: quality and sustainability.
360° Fully Wrapped Sidewalls A 360–degree, fully wrapped sidewall that eliminates the need for tip fill, while effectively tying the whole snowboard together. A technology that delivers incredibly tight tolerances for improved board life and durability.
Factory Tuned Detuning of the tip and tail contact points on all snowboards for a catch-free ride before they leave the factory.
SPLITBOARD TECH
Universal Splitboard Insert Packs Provide a wide stance range, while at the same time delivering critical micro adjustability.
Karakoram Ultra Clip
Karakoram’s splitboard clip is powerful, easy to use, and light. Once joined, the UltraClip fully constrains the seam of your splitboard to eliminate seam rattling, seam shearing, and seam rolling. The lever locks in the touring position as well to eliminate unwanted movement on the ascent
SKINS
Mix Mohair Mix Mohair skins use a mix of mohair and nylon and combine the benefits of both materials. The mix of materials provide the best balance in climbing and gliding properties.
